Management Commentary

During the public earnings call held alongside the Q1 2026 release, Precision leadership focused primarily on updates to the firm’s research and development pipeline, rather than granular quarterly operational results. Per publicly available call transcripts, management noted that ongoing investments in its high-precision medical and industrial optical product lines have contributed to near-term operating expenses, which aligns with the negative EPS reported for the quarter. Leadership did not offer specific commentary on the lack of reported revenue for Q1 2026 during the call, though they did reference that the company is currently in a pre-commercial phase for its core new product offerings, which may lead to uneven financial disclosures until full commercial launch. No off-the-cuff or prepared remarks from executive team members included specific claims about future financial performance during the call. Forward Guidance

Precision (POCI) did not issue formal quantitative forward guidance alongside its Q1 2026 earnings release, a choice that management attributed to the high degree of uncertainty surrounding the timeline for its upcoming product commercialization efforts. Leadership noted that it expects to share additional details around expected launch windows for its lead optical product candidates in future public disclosures, though no specific timeline for those updates was provided during the call. Analysts covering the firm have indicated that the lack of formal guidance is consistent with their prior expectations for POCI, given the early stage of its core development projects. Some analysts have noted that any updates around commercial milestones could potentially shift market sentiment for the stock in upcoming months, though no concrete timelines for those milestones have been confirmed by the company as of this analysis. Market Reaction

Trading activity for POCI in the trading sessions immediately following the Q1 2026 earnings release fell within normal volume ranges, per aggregated market data. No extreme intraday price fluctuations were observed in the sessions after the release, a trend that some market observers attribute to low consensus expectations for the quarter, given the company’s previously disclosed pre-commercial status. Many analysts covering the stock have indicated that they are holding off on updating their outlooks for POCI until additional operational and financial disclosures are made available, particularly around revenue generation timelines. Retail and institutional investor sentiment following the release has been largely neutral, with most market participants waiting for further clarity on the firm’s commercial roadmap before adjusting their positions.
